Piper's game last Friday was a loss, but they didn't let that memory haunt them on Friday. They came out on top against the South Plantation Paladins by a score of 31-21. Considering the Bengals' offense had been struggling lately, the high-scoring outing was a much-needed turnaround.
Piper can attribute much of their success to Jahnard Young, who rushed for 145 yards while picking up 7.3 yards per carry.
They were just one part of a punishing run game: Piper was unstoppable on the ground and finished the game with 237 rushing yards. That's the most rushing yards they've posted since the start of last season.
Piper's defense stepped up as well, laying out Nixon Kalish. five times. The heavy lifting was done by Jaytoin Thomas and Khalil Jefferson, who racked up four sacks between them. Thomas is also crushing it when it comes to total tackles: he's made at least seven every time he's taken the field this season. Another thorn in South Plantation's side was Luchung Manyou, who picked up a sack, made six total tackles (3.0 for loss), and defended one pass.
Despite the loss, South Plantation still got an impressive performance from Kamary Cooper, who rushed for 141 yards and one TD on only ten carries, and also picked up 90 receiving yards and a pair of touchdowns. The bulk of those rushing yards came from one huge play: a run that gained an incredible 90 yards. Another player making a difference was Kalish, who threw for 200 yards and a pair of TDs.

Piper's first win this season bumped their record up to 1-2. As for South Plantation, they dropped their record down to 1-1 with the loss, which was their fourth straight at home dating back to last season.
Looking ahead, Piper will take on Plantation at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. As for South Plantation, they will challenge Nova at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. The contest will give the Paladins their first taste of in-conference action this season.
